Compared to subjective trading, quantitative trading aids investors/traders in numerous ways:
Emotional Trading: Quantitative trading helps eliminate the impact of emotions on trading decisions, leading to more objective and rational transactions.
Trade Execution: This method can automatically execute strategies and swiftly respond to market shifts, reducing human error and delays.
Big Data Analysis: It leverages large-scale data and analytical tools to uncover and analyze market patterns and trends, identifying potential trading opportunities.
Risk Control: Quantitative trading employs strict risk management and stop-loss strategies to shield portfolios from significant losses.
Statistical Advantage: Investors can utilize statistical principles and mathematical models to enhance portfolio returns and risk management capabilities.
Market Arbitrage: By rapidly reacting to market price differences and potential conflicts of interest, it enables market arbitrage for profit.
Optimizing Trading Costs: Algorithmic and strategic execution in quantitative trading can lower trading costs, including low-latency and high-frequency trading.
Diversified Investments: It facilitates the easy implementation of diverse investment strategies across stocks, futures, forex, and other asset classes.
Overall, quantitative trading aids investors in improving efficiency and returns in decision-making, execution, and risk management.
